2011 Valle d'Aosta Open
The 2011 Valle d'Aosta Open was a professional tennis tournament played on hard courts. It was the first edition of the tournament which was part of the 2011 ATP Challenger Tour. It took place in Courmayeur, Italy between 31 January – 6 February 2011.
